ON MODIFIED SECOND ORDER SLOPE ROTATABLE DESIGNS USING INCOMPLETE BLOCK DESIGNS WITH UNEQUAL BLOCK SIZES

B. Re. Victorbabu (India)

Received August 18, 2006; Revised June 18, 2007

Abstract
In this paper, new method of constructions of modified second order slope rotatable designs (SOSRD) using symmetrical unequal block arrangements (SUBA) with two unequal sizes and pairwise balanced designs (PBD) are suggested. In this method the number of design points required is in some cases less than the number required in Victorbabu [11] method of construction of modified SOSRD using balanced incomplete block designs. Further, a new method of construction of three level modified SOSRD using incomplete block designs with unequal block sizes is presented. The modified SOSRD can be viewed as SOSRD constructed with the technique of augmentation of second order rotatable design (SORD) using incomplete block designs with unequal block sizes to SOSRD. These designs are useful in parts to estimate responses and slopes with spherical variance functions.
